MANATEE -- An effort to put the topic of construction of a bridge at Tara on an upcoming Manatee County Commission agenda for discussion today failed in a 3-3 vote.
East Manatee residents want the issue discussed in public again, and would like to see plans for the bridges construction dropped from the countys planning priority list, Commissioner Vanessa Baugh told the board at its regular meeting Tuesday.
It is their desire ultimately for it to be removed, from the priority list, and not be built at all, Baugh said, acknowledging that the bridge has been in county plans since 1989.
Voting in favor of a motion to put the item on a future board agenda were commissioners Carol Whitmore, Michael Gallen and Baugh.
Voting against the motion were commissioners John Chappie, Betsy Benac and Larry Bustle. Commissioner Robin DiSabatino was absent.
The two-lane Tara bridge would span the Braden River near where it intersects with Tara Boulevard. Officials said there is no money to build it, but that it remains on its priority list.
